Transaction e63f0279abd4a7c1d1baaa5c9bdf601381921074649f052dc67ecd85b6d0fe7b

block
95afb924c2148a7945276cee6a36cf98bc390f59b3dc53c15dce493d6c70dedb

1 Input

96 Outputs